It is quite strange and I feel frustrated and let down by MS. Why X150E was ruled out after promising the upgrade? What is the difference from X150Q? I can see that 150E is dual sim and may be the LTE support bands are different.
Amazon India is still showing it as up-gradable to Windows 10.
8MP Autofocus Camera with LED Flash, Video Recording with 2MP Front Camera
5-inch (12.7 cm) HD IPS capacitive touchscreen with 720 x 1080 pixels resolution and 294 ppi pixel density with BLU NexLens Technology (OGS)
Windows Phone v8.1 operating system (upgradable to Windows v10) with Qualcomm Snapdragon 410, Quad-Core 1.2GHz Cortex A53, 64-Bit architecture with Adreno 306 GPU; 1GB RAM, 8GB internal memory expandable up to 32GB and 4G dual SIM
2500mAH lithium-polymer battery providing talk-time of 26 hours and standby time of 775 hours
